This post was last edited by FORREST_GUMP on 2016-9-22 07:54. Atmospheric pressure storage tanks are related only to pressure, not to the material used. It can be either a metal or a non-metal. I guess your organization classifies them as atmospheric pressure metal storage tanks and atmospheric pressure non-metallic storage tanks.
Atmospheric pressure storage tanks include metal and non-metallic ones
Atmospheric pressure metal storage tanks refer to vertical cylindrical welded steel storage tanks that are constructed on a homogeneous foundation with sufficient bearing capacity, with their bottoms in close contact with the foundation; such tanks are used for storing liquid petroleum, petrochemical products, and other similar liquids at atmospheric pressure (with a design pressure of less than or equal to 6.9 kPa gauge pressure at the tank top).
